ECL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

1,250 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Ecolab (ECL)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$35.7B — up 13% from $31.7B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 128 funds opened new ECL positions and 73 closed out — a net gain of 55 holders — while 506 added to existing stakes and 411 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Sarasin & Partners, adding an estimated $170M. The largest seller was C WorldWide Group, exiting entirely with an estimated $253M sold.
